Hi, I tried to add a gpx layer then flyTo a place near the gpx layer, using the flyTo function defined by leaflet.
Then I observed that the gpx layer fills up all the map window when the map is zoomed in.
A example code is as follows: https://jsfiddle.net/73945Lcn/2/
Is there a way to avoid this happening? Seems that the gpx layer is also zoomed in or out during the flyto process (which is different from the behaviour of a marker).
